8.1.1    Z 17-07, OCP Bylaw No. 0100.49 and Zoning Amendment Bylaw No. 0154.59 and 0154.66 (Post PH), 2211 Campbell Road (Blackmun Bay)

It was moved and seconded

Resolution No. C358/19

THAT Council deny the application (File: Z17-07) to amend the City of West Kelowna Zoning Bylaw for 2211 Campbell Road; and,

THAT Council rescind first and second readings of the City of West Kelowna Official Community Plan Amendment Bylaw No. 0100.49 and Zoning Amendment Bylaw No. 0154.59 and No. 0154.66 (File: Z17-07); and,

THAT Council direct staff to close File: Z17-07.

CARRIED; Opposed: Councillor Zilkie

Information report from Parks & Fleet Operations Manager

  • It was moved and seconded

    Resolution No.C365/19

    THAT Council support the application to the Community Resiliency Investment Program seeking funding for 2020 prescriptions and operational fuel treatments; and,

    THAT Council authorise staff to use grant funds based on the priorities in the Community Wildfire Protection Plan Update and criteria of the Community Resiliency Investment Program; and,

    THAT Council authorise staff to include $64,500 in the 2020 operating budget for prescriptions and treatments, subject to Community Resiliency Investment Program funding support; and,

    THAT Council authorise the Mayor and City Clerk to execute the funding agreement.

    CARRIED UNANIMOUSLY
  • It was moved and seconded

    Resolution No.C366/19

    THAT Council support the City of West Kelowna’s application to the Community Emergency Preparedness Fund’s Volunteer and Composite Fire Department Training and Equipment Program; and,

    THAT Council permit West Kelowna Fire Rescue to use approved grant funding to purchase software and hardware and to facilitate firefighter resiliency training; and,

    THAT Council authorise staff to include $24,964 in the 2020 operations budget for training and equipment purchases, subject to funding being provided through the Community Emergency Preparedness Fund; and,

    THAT Council authorise the Mayor and Corporate Officer to execute the funding agreement.

    CARRIED UNANIMOUSLY
